One significant side is that dental implants are designed to be anchored into the jawbone, which suggests they are unbiased of adjacent teeth. Unlike dental bridges, which often require the alteration of neighboring teeth, implants can fill the hole with out compromising the health or structure of those surrounding teeth.


This independence helps preserve the integrity of adjacent teeth. When a tooth is lost, there could be a natural tendency for neighboring teeth to tilt or shift into the empty house. Such movement can result in misalignment, which may affect chew and overall oral health. By inserting an implant, you effectively prevent this potential shift, selling better alignment in the long run.

Additionally, dental implants help keep bone density in the jaw. A natural tooth root offers stimulation to the encompassing bone, preserving it healthy and robust. When a tooth is missing, the bone can begin to deteriorate because of lack of stimulation. With a dental implant mimicking a natural root, bone loss could be minimized, which not directly benefits adjacent teeth by preserving the general structure of the dental arch.


While dental implants are advantageous, improper placement can impact neighboring teeth. If an implant is positioned too shut to a different tooth, it might exert undue stress on that tooth, leading to discomfort or potential harm. Proper planning and imaging techniques are important for avoiding such points.

Another consideration is the impression of implants on bite pressure. When a single tooth is missing, the load of chewing could shift to adjacent teeth, potentially leading to put on or strain. Implants restore proper chew dynamics by redistributing forces within the mouth, which can shield surrounding teeth from undue stress.
